| | Word setup This is a new computer. I am trying to set up Word and it will NOT accept the product key. Why? |

| | Re: Word setup "Nan" <Nan@xxxxxx> wrote in message news:1C06FB1D-39CB-4B6A-8410-F50D3BF21BB4@xxxxxx Quote: > This is a new computer. I am trying to set up Word and it will NOT accept > the product key. Why? Which product key? If you have a laptop, you can't use the product key on the sticker found on the underside because that is the Windows Vista key. If you have a desktop, you can't use the product key on the sticker found on the side panel because that is the Windows Vista key. The MS Word key will be on the MS Word packaging. In all probability, you have a trial version in which case you will have to purchase MS Office if you want a key. -- Mike Hall - MVP http://msmvps.com/blogs/mikehall/default.aspx |

| | Re: Word setup "Nan" <Nan@xxxxxx> wrote in message news:1C06FB1D-39CB-4B6A-8410-F50D3BF21BB4@xxxxxx Quote: > This is a new computer. I am trying to set up Word and it will NOT accept > the product key. Why? numbers. An 8 (number eight) can look a lot like a B (letter B) and a Q (letter Q) can look a lot like an O (letter O) and so on. It's a common issue. And, the product key will be on the packaging (do not throw away the disk packaging!) that your copy of Word came in. |
